Gaumont hires from MarVista for sales

Narcos producer Gaumont Television has appointed a MarVista Entertainment executive as its president of worldwide distribution.

Vanessa Shapiro will report directly to vice-CEO Christophe Riandee, dividing her time between the company’s Paris and LA offices.

Shapiro will be responsible for the worldwide sales and distribution of Gaumont Television’s entire catalogue, including drama series, animation titles and French series.

She will also oversee new and existing business development, sales, pre-sales and coproductions, as well as managing the marketing needs for the firm.

Erik Pack previously held the title of president of international distribution and production but Gaumont has not yet commented on the future of his role or stated whether Shapiro is a direct replacement.

Shapiro’s new colleagues will include Gene Stein, president of Gaumont Television US; Nicolas Atlan, president of Gaumont Animation; and Isabelle DeGeorges, the firm’s senior VP of France.

Elizabeth Dreyer, senior VP of European coproductions; Hana Zidek, VP of international distribution; and Nicola Andrews, VP of international distribution, will now report to Shapiro.

“Given all of our recent activity on both the drama and animation fronts, coupled with the fact that Gene and Nicolas are both in LA, we decided to move our sales and distribution from London to LA,” said Riandee.

“Vanessa is the perfect hire for this position given her outstanding track record and 20-plus years of experience, her solid and longstanding relationships around the world, and her strong financial background.”

Shapiro was previously executive VP of distribution Marvista Entertainment, a position she had held since 2007.

Prior to MarVista, she was with Sony Pictures Entertainment from 1997 to 2007, where she held numerous roles throughout her tenure, ultimately serving as director of worldwide pay television.

Last October, the animation division of Gaumont reorganised its Paris-based office.
